Referrals - If the saying isn"t documented as it goes, it didn"t occur. Certainly you might have referred your patient for massage therapy, but where is it in the SOAP note? If you"re trying to get that massage visit paid, you better be able to track a referral someplace. Insurance company denying the importance of your care? Where is your documentation affecting your patient"s visit to the Orthopedic Surgeon whose recommendation was to continue with chiropractic attention? You ought to be documenting all referrals to and from your practice. An auditor who finds none and looks through your notes does not conclude that you don"t ever refer. He believes that he"s located a chiropractor who looks to see what other blunders he can find and fails to record thoroughly.

Stress - Stress can worsen your TMJ pain. People frequently clench their jaw when they"re experiencing anxiety. Tension is also a cause of teeth grinding and tightened facial muscles . For your treatment, you may want to contemplate chiropractic massages which considerably reduce anxiety and relax muscles. Another option would be to take yoga courses where anxiety is released through breathing tasks as well as stretches.
